List of Italian Pokémon names

This list is a record of the official Italian spellings for Pokémon names. Names are listed by number in the order dictated by the National Pokédex.

The Italian names of most Pokémon are the same as their English names, and are not listed below. Although these names are spelled identically to how they are spelled in English, they are pronounced in a way that approximates their English pronunciation; for example, Pikachu is pronounced as "pìcaciu".[1] Type: Null and the Paradox Pokémon (with the exceptions of Koraidon and Miraidon) are the only Pokémon that have different names in Italian than they do in English.
